Customer Experience Representative - Overnight - SeaTac Airport
Job Description
Overview
Enterprise Mobility operates the Enterprise Rent-A-Car, National Car Rental, and Alamo car rental brands and has frequently been named one of the top places to work. Enterprise Mobility is the largest and fastest growing privately owned automotive rental and leasing company in North America and we are hiring now! We are working towards our shared vision to be the world's best and most trusted mobility company.
The National/Alamo brand of Enterprise Mobility has an exciting opportunity for an Overnight Customer Experience Representative (CXR). The Customer Service Representative provides superior, friendly, and efficient transactions and offering company approved services and products to provide a positive experience for all customers. This position also facilitates the rental process through verification and documentation of all necessary driver information to provide for an efficient and timely rental and return experience.

The pay for this position starts at $22.50 / hour, plus an additional $1.25 per hour between the hours on 11pm and 6am. Employees in this position earn between $22.50 - $24.75 / hour depending on length of service.
This position is located at SeaTac Airport (SEA)- 3150 S 160th St. Ste. 509 SeaTac, WA 98188.
We offer a robustBenefits Package including, but not limited to:
- Paid Time Off, starting with 14 days off in your first year + 6 paid holidays
- Health, Dental, Vision insurance; Life Insurance; Prescription coverage
- Employee discounts on car rentals, car purchases and much more!
- 401(k) retirement plan with company match and profit sharing

Responsibilities
We are hiring now for immediate openings. Responsibilities include:
- Meet and greet customers in a professional, friendly, and timely manner
- Provide superior, efficient customer service by understanding and communicating rental terms and conditions, vehicle features and other services
- Use Company approved sales and service techniques to determine customer needs and offer optional protection products, upgrades, fuel options and other additional equipment
- Offer additional customer assistance by offering directions, maps, local area information, and appropriate service information
- Answer incoming calls for reservations, rate quotes, general questions and answers, provide information and resolution for customers, other branches, and other vendors
- Place outgoing calls for callback management, and miscellaneous calls as assigned
- Assist to assess condition of rental upon return
- Notify Management of any known customer problems
- Notify Management of any known vehicle problems and any required vehicle maintenance
- Continuously build knowledge and skills, pursue on the job training and development opportunities and any company sponsored classroom training
- Perform miscellaneous and backup duties job-related duties as assigned

Qualifications
- Must be at least 18 years old
- High School Diploma or G.E.D. required
- Must have a valid driver's license with no more than 2 moving violations and/or at-fault accidents on driving record within the past 3 years.
- Must be authorized to work in the United States and not require work authorization sponsorship by our company for this position now or in the future.
- Must have one year of customer service retail or administrative support experience
- Must have worked 6 months or more at most recent employer
